Context
Released on June 1, 2004, 'Sweet Sixteen' marked Sarah Geronimo's debut studio album, coming after her victory in the reality talent show 'Star for a Night'. This album positioned her as a rising star in the Philippine music scene, introducing her powerful vocals and emotional delivery to a wider audience.
